How to Spot a Real Licensed Casino from a Rogue
It’s not hard, but you have to be smart. Here’s a quick checklist I use.
- Check the Footer: Every legitimate UKGC-licensed casino must display the UK Gambling Commission logo and licence number. If you don’t see it, run.
- Look for the ’18+’ Tag: Real sites plaster this everywhere. If it’s hidden or hard to find, it’s a bad sign.
- Read the T&Cs: I know, it’s boring. But look for the withdrawal section. If it’s complicated or hidden, that’s a red flag.
- Search for ‘Withdrawal Time’: Type this into Google along with the casino name. See what real players say.

A Final Word on Responsible Gambling
I’m an old man. I’ve seen people lose their shirts. Gambling should be fun, not a way to make a living. The best casino websites UK 2026 licensed and trusted all have tools to help you control your play. Set a deposit limit. Use the reality check feature. If you feel like you’re chasing losses, take a break.
There are places like GamCare and GamStop that can help. Don’t be ashamed to ask for help. It’s just a game at the end of the day.
